微信开发者工具如何使用本地服务器

微信开发者工具是一款用于微信小程序开发的集成开发环境(IDE),它提供了一系列的工具和功能,方便开发者进行小程序的开发、调试和发布。其中,微信开发者工具内置了一个本地服务器,可以用于开发阶段的本地调试。本文将详细介绍如何在微信开发者工具中使用本地服务器。

1. 创建本地服务器

在微信开发者工具中使用本地服务器,首先需要在本地搭建一个服务器。可以选择使用现有的服务器框架,如Express、Koa等,也可以使用Node.js自带的http模块创建一个简单的服务器。以下是使用http模块创建一个简单的本地服务器的代码示例:

const http = require('http');

http.createServer((req, res) => {
  res.statusCode = 200;
  res.setHeader('Content-Type', 'text/plain');
  res.end('Hello, World!');
}).listen(3000, '127.0.0.1', () => {
  console.log('Server running at 
});

运行以上代码,可以在本地创建一个简单的服务器,监听本地的3000端口。当访问World!

2. 配置微信开发者工具

在微信开发者工具中使用本地服务器,需要进行一些配置。首先,打开微信开发者工具,在左侧导航栏中找到并点击项目,然后点击右侧的本地设置

本地设置中,可以看到本地开发设置的选项卡。在此选项卡中,可以进行本地服务器的配置。

2.1. 基本设置

首先,在域名信息的下拉框中,选择自定义。然后,在请求域名的输入框中,填入服务器的地址,例如`

2.2. HTTPS设置

微信开发者工具支持在本地进行HTTPS的调试,可以在HTTPS设置的选项卡中进行配置。如果需要使用HTTPS进行调试,可以选择开启,然后点击生成按钮生成证书。

2.3. 代理设置

如果本地服务器需要通过代理进行访问外部网络资源,可以在代理设置的选项卡中进行配置。在HTTP代理的输入框中,填入代理服务器的地址和端口。

3. 启动本地调试

完成微信开发者工具的配置后,可以点击工具栏上的编译按钮进行编译,然后点击预览按钮启动本地调试。

微信开发者工具会自动打开一个调试窗口,可以在此窗口中查看小程序的运行情况。同时,微信开发者工具会向本地服务器发送请求,获取小程序的页面和资源。

在微信开发者工具中,可以通过点击左侧导航栏中的页面文件查看页面的渲染效果。可以在调试窗口中查看控制台的输出,以便进行调试。

总结

本文介绍了如何在微信开发者工具中使用本地服务器进行小程序的本地调试。首先,需要在本地搭建一个服务器,可以使用http模块创建一个简单的服务器。然后,在微信开发者工具中进行配置,包括基本设置、HTTPS设置和代理设置。最后,点击编译和预览按钮启动本地调试。

本地服务器的使用可以提高开发效率,方便调试和测试。同时,注意保证服务器的安全性和稳定性,以免对开发过程造成影响。

以下为markdown语法的表格标识:

Header 1 Header 2
Cell 1 Cell 2
Cell 3 Cell 4

**以下为mermaid语法中的sequenceDiagram标识: